New Vocabulary
disaster - something that causes damage or destruction
earthquake - a shaking of the ground
erupting - bursting out
lava - melted rock that flows from a volcano
pitch - to rise and fall
volcano - an opening in the earth that spews out lava, ash, and hot gases
fossils - plant and animal remains that have changed to stone
packs - groups of animals
prey - an animal hunted by another animal for food
remains - things left behind after something has died
reptiles - cold-blooded animals, such as snakes, turtles, and lizards
